Message type: E = Error
Message class: BS - Status Management
Message number: 060
Message text: No authorization for deleting user status &
When deleting the user status &v1& the authorization object B_USERST_T
is checked for the following values:
,,Status profile,,&v2&
,,Object type,,&v3&
,,Authorization key,,&v4&
,,Activity,,06
You do not have the required authorization.
You may not delete user status &v1&.
Contact your system administrator for the necessary authorization.

- No authorization for deleting user status & ?The SAP error message BS060 indicates that a user is attempting to delete a user status but does not have the necessary authorization to perform this action. This error typically arises in the context of user status management within SAP, where specific permissions are required to modify or delete statuses associated with various objects (like orders, projects, etc.).
Cause:
- Lack of Authorization: The user does not have the required authorization object to delete the user status. This could be due to missing roles or authorizations in their user profile.
- Status Configuration: The user status may be configured in such a way that it cannot be deleted due to business rules or settings in the system.
- Object Locking: The object associated with the user status might be locked or in a state that prevents deletion.
Solution:
Check Authorizations:
- Review the user's roles and authorizations in the SAP system. You can do this by using transaction code SU53 immediately after the error occurs to see what authorization checks failed.
- Ensure that the user has the necessary authorization objects, particularly those related to user status management (e.g.,
I_STATUS
).Modify User Roles:
- If the user lacks the necessary authorizations, you may need to modify their roles or assign additional roles that include the required authorizations.
- Work with your SAP security team to ensure that the user has the appropriate permissions.
Check User Status Configuration:
- Review the configuration of the user status in transaction BS02 (for user status management) to ensure that the status can be deleted.
- If the status is set as "not deletable," you may need to change its configuration or consult with a functional consultant.
